2-mavzu. Ma’lumotlar bazasida tashqi bog’lanish va
birlashmalar.
Rasmda gipotetik korxona ishchilari to'g'risidagi ba'zi ma'lumotlarni o'z ichiga olgan jadval
(5 daraja nisbati) ko'rsatilgan. Jadval satrlari katakchalarga mos keladi. Har bir satr aslida
haqiqiy dunyodagi bitta ob'ektning tavsifi (bu holda, xodim), uning xususiyatlari ustunlarda
joylashgan. Aloqaviy munosabatlar sub'ektlar to'plamiga, koreyslar esa mavjudliklarga mos
keladi. Jadvaldagi munosabat munosabatlarini ifodalaydigan ustunlar deyiladi atributlar.
Har bir atribut domenda aniqlanadi, shuning uchun domenni berilgan atribut uchun yaroqli
qiymatlar to'plami sifatida ko'rish mumkin. Xuddi shu sohada bir xil munosabatlarning bir
nechta atributlari va hattoki har xil munosabatlarning atributlari aniqlanishi mumkin.
Qiymati topllarni yagona aniqlaydigan atribut deyiladi kalit (yoki oddiygina) kalit). Kalit
"Kadrlar raqami" atributidir, chunki uning qiymati korxonaning har bir xodimi uchun o'ziga
xosdir. Agar koridorlar faqat bir nechta atributlarning qiymatlarini birlashtirish orqali aniqlansa,
u holda bu munosabat tarkibli kalitga ega deyiladi.